摘要
本文通过对TIAS系统平台的分析,针对目标用户需求,提供了两种控制中心技术方案,即完全分布式的中心、车站监控"点"部署方式,以及整个线路集中监控的中心"线"式部署方式。通过以上分析研究,对未来我国城市轨道交通体系建设,具有显著的社会、经济效益和参考价值。
Through the analysis of the TIAS system platform, two kinds of control center technology solutions are provided for the target user’s needs: a fully distributed center and station monitoring "point" deployment mode, and a centralized "line" deployment mode for centralized monitoring of the entire line. Through the above analysis and research, it has significant social and economic benefits and reference value for the future construction of urban rail transit system in China.
